> Add a data() function to the Matrix class to access the internal data.
> This is useful for code that needs to use the matrix contents as a
> linear array, as shown by the RkISP1::Ccm::process() function that needs
> to copy the matrix data to a local variable. Simplify that function by
> using the new accessor.

> +/**
> + * \fn Matrix::data()
> + * \brief Access the matrix data as a linear array
> + *
> + * Access the contents of the matrix as a one-dimensional linear array of
> + * values in row-major order. The size of the array is equal to the product of
> + * the number of rows and columns of the matrix (Rows x Cols).
> + *
> + * \return A span referencing the matrix data as a linear array
> + */
